Today we’d like to introduce you to Katie Velarde.
Thanks for sharing your story with us Katie. So, let’s start at the beginning and we can move on from there.
I was born with arts, crafts and entrepreneurship in my veins. I grew up with six siblings and two hard-working parents. I met my husband at the age of 14, so I was blessed with a second mother and father who helped raise me. However, my love for creativity and wellness is not where I started. I started where we are “expected” to start. I finished traditional schooling with a high school diploma and college obtaining a bachelor’s and master’s degree in business, all with accolades and honors (which fade as time passes).
Then I stayed the typical course, for about 12 years, I held down increasingly stressful corporate or non-profit organizational jobs. I was always promoted quickly and thought of as a hard worker, great leader and competent. Do you know what this got me? The promotions. Do you know what those promotions came with? They came with more stress, less time with family, more hours and a salary. They brought on physical and emotional stress I underestimated for way too long. I kept “pushing through” and was crazy busy. Isn’t this the measure for success? I thought so too.
My escape from the stress was my love for aromatherapy and gemstones. In February of 2015, I launched an Etsy shop, Glitter Zen. The name includes my favorite color, glitter, and the feeling making aromatherapy jewelry brings me, zen. It was a side hobby and over the years it grew and grew! I was fascinated at the way people reacted to what I made and it warmed my heart that my peace could being peace and smiles to others. in the Fall of 2017, I did my first live vendor show with my jewelry displayed. I was beaming with joy and I have never looked back! I have done vendor shows all over Colorado. I love meeting new people and making friends across the state and online!
In March of 2018 my life changed forever, I was in a very demanding and stressful job and I needed a surgery. I did not recover after surgery. My body said “enough”. I had three weeks off and had to go back to work half time. I could barely make it through a day. My adrenal glands were over my fast-paced, busy bee, please everyone in my path lifestyle. On June 30, 2018, I ended up having to leave my full-time job to find a part-time job to sustain income but honor my body’s needs for wellness. My part-time job I had found was not a good fit in any way. However, I am ever grateful for that job because I met an amazing woman and current mentor, Faye Marquez, besides my amazing husband, she has been my #1 fan and supporter to do what I love! I invested more of my time and talents into my hobby, Glitter Zen and I began to share Young Living Essential Oils. Young Living got me over the wellness hump and it is the best investment I have ever made (less than $190!). I am ever grateful to have found true therapeutic essential oils.
Fast forward two years, I am quarantined at home while I write this article but am blessed beyond measure! I have a website, www.glitterzen.com which I launched this year and I have a team of essential oil lovers who have taught me more than I have taught them. I have finally found my balance and my tribe. I’m glad it only took me 40 years. LOL. I like to think I have another half of my life to do this right! I know my family more, I see them, and I get to participate in school and daytime activities. I am not racing the clock or losing sleep over evaluations that don’t capture our hearts. My study of gemstones and essential oils has given me my life back and a life worth truly living! This is finally me and I am happy.
